Output 95691fba060338e3f148c195b598c7219db05ca3bdbbe73d58bbc5fea03614f1:1

value
29804632939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c235d300cdaeba4d81e301dfacff803f53d7fbdf OP_EQUAL
address
3KPuVXorye6erKu94FxAok73h5DrhkYTLo
transaction
95691fba060338e3f148c195b598c7219db05ca3bdbbe73d58bbc5fea03614f1
spent
true